Understanding Gold and Silver Purity


One of the first factors we look at when valuing jewelry is purity. Gold and silver are rarely used in their pure form because they are too soft for everyday wear. Instead, they are blended with other metals to improve durability.


Gold purity is measured in karats. Common examples include 10k, 14k, and 18k gold. A higher karat rating indicates a greater amount of pure gold within the jewelry. Silver is often marked as sterling silver or 925, which means it is 92.5 percent pure silver. These markings are a helpful starting point, but professional testing ensures accuracy.


The Role of Weight in Gold and Silver Pricing


The next step in determining value is weight. Jewelry is weighed using professional scales that measure in grams. Only the precious metal content is considered, not stones, clasps, or non-precious components. This ensures you are paid fairly based on the actual gold or silver contained in your item.


Heavier pieces with higher purity naturally carry more value. Even small items can add up, especially if you are selling multiple pieces at once.


How Market Prices Affect Your Payout


Gold and silver prices fluctuate daily based on global markets. Factors like inflation, currency strength, and economic uncertainty all influence precious metal prices. Because of this, the value of your jewelry today may differ from what it was worth last year or even last month.

The Condition of Your Jewelry Does Not Define Its Value


Many people assume jewelry must be flawless to be worth anything. That is not true when selling for scrap value. Bent rings, broken chains, single earrings, or outdated styles still hold value if they contain gold or silver.


The condition of your jewelry usually does not affect its worth unless it has collectible or resale appeal. This makes selling old or damaged items an excellent option if you no longer plan to repair or wear them.


Evaluating Jewelry Beyond Gold and Silver


Diamonds and gemstones may add value, depending on size and quality, but the primary focus remains on precious metal content. In some cases, stones are removed before weighing. Luxury watches and branded jewelry can be evaluated separately when applicable.
